The cheapest way to get from Alburquerque to Madrid is to drive which costs €55 - €85 and takes 4h 19m.
The fastest way to get from Alburquerque to Madrid is to taxi and fly which takes 2h 26m and costs €120 - €400.
No, there is no direct bus from Alburquerque to Madrid. However, there are services departing from Villar Del Rey and arriving at Estación Sur de Autobuses via Cáceres. The journey, including transfers, takes approximately 6h 24m.
No, there is no direct train from Alburquerque to Madrid. However, there are services departing from San Vicente De Alcantara and arriving at Madrid Chamartín via Caceres. The journey, including transfers, takes approximately 6h 14m.
The distance between Alburquerque and Madrid is 394 km. The road distance is 363.7 km.
